Oscars 2010 for Oscar Awards 2010 Winners or the 82nd Academy Awards, presented by the Academy of Motion Picture Arts and Sciences, honored the best Oscar Winning Movies of 2009 and took place March 7, 2010, at the Kodak Theatre in Hollywood, Los Angeles, California beginning at 5:30 p.m. PST/8:30 p.m. EST (01:30 UTC, March 8). The Oscar winners 2009 list as follows,
Best Picture – The Hurt Locker
Actor in a Leading Role – Jeff Bridges(Crazy Heart)
Actor in a Supporting Role – Christoph Waltz(Inglourious Basterds)
Actress in a Leading Role – Sandra Bullock(The Blind Side)
Actress in a Supporting Role – Mo’Nique
Animated Feature Film – Up(Pete Docter)
Art Direction – Avatar (Rick Carter and Robert Stromberg (Art Direction); Kim Sinclair (Set Decoration) )
Cinematography – Avatar(Mauro Fiore)
Costume Design – The Young Victoria(Sandy Powell)
Directing – The Hurt Locker(Kathryn Bigelow)
Documentary Feature – The Cove(Louie Psihoyos and Fisher Stevens)
Documentary Short – Music by Prudence(Roger Ross Williams and Elinor Burkett)
Film Editing – The Hurt Locker(Bob Murawski and Chris Innis)
Foreign Language Film – The Secret in Their Eyes(Directed by Juan José Campanella)
Makeup – Star Trek(Barney Burman, Mindy Hall and Joel Harlow)
Music (Original Score) – Up(Michael Giacchino)
Music (Original Song) – Crazy Heart “The Weary Kind (Theme from Crazy Heart)”
Short Film (Animated) – Logorama Nicolas Schmerkin
Short Film (Live Action) – The New Tenants Joachim Back and Tivi Magnusson
Sound Editing – The Hurt Locker(Paul N.J. Ottosson)
Sound Mixing – The Hurt Locker(Paul N.J. Ottosson and Ray Beckett)
Visual Effects – Avatar
Writing (Adapted Screenplay) – Precious: Based on the Novel ‘Push’ by Sapphire
Writing (Original Screenplay) – The Hurt Locker(Written by Mark Boal)
